2) 5x-2>13 or -4x≥8
i.e. 5x>15 or x≤8/(-4) = -2 (since dividing by negative inequality reverses)
Or x>3 or x ≤-2
Hence solution is two regions to the right of 3 excluding 3 and left of -2 including -2.
Graph b is the correct match.
3) -25≤9x+2<20
Subtract 2
-27≤9x<18: Now divide by positive 9
-3≤x<2
Hence graph is the region between -3 and 2 including only -3.
Graph a is correct matching for question 3.

a.
x = cost of adult ticket
y = cost of student ticket
cost of adult ticket is twice the cost of a student ticket
x = 2y
number of adult tickets = 64
number of student tickets = 132
cost of all adult tickets = 64x
cost of all student tickets = 132y
cost of all adult and student tickets combined: 64x + 132y
cost of all adult and student tickets combined: 1040
This gives us the equation:
64x + 132y = 1040
b.
Use substitution to solve the system of equations. Since x = 2y, where you see x in the second equation, substitute it with 2y.
64(2y) + 132y = 1040
128y + 132y = 1040
260y = 1040
y = 1040/260
y = 4
x = 2y = 2(4) = 8
adult ticket: $8
student ticket: $4
